package com.google.common.collect;
import com.google.common.annotations.Beta;
import com.google.common.annotations.GwtCompatible;
import com.google.common.base.Objects;
import com.google.errorprone.annotations.CanIgnoreReturnValue;
import java.util.Collection;
import java.util.Iterator;
import java.util.Map;
import java.util.Set;
import javax.annotation.Nullable;
/**
* A map which forwards all its method calls to another map. Subclasses should
* override one or more methods to modify the behavior of the backing map as
* desired per the <a
* href="http://en.wikipedia.org/wiki/Decorator_pattern">decorator pattern</a>.
*
* <p>Warning: The methods of {@code ForwardingMap} forward
* <i>indiscriminately to the methods of the delegate. For example,
* overriding {@link #put} alone <i>will not change the behavior of {@link
* #putAll}, which can lead to unexpected behavior. In this case, you should
* override {@code putAll} as well, either providing your own implementation, or
* delegating to the provided {@code standardPutAll} method.
*
* <p>{@code default} method warning: This class does not forward calls to {@code
* default} methods. Instead, it inherits their default implementations. When those implementations
* invoke methods, they invoke methods on the {@code ForwardingMap}.
*
* <p>Each of the {@code standard} methods, where appropriate, use {@link
* Objects#equal} to test equality for both keys and values. This may not be
* the desired behavior for map implementations that use non-standard notions of
* key equality, such as a {@code SortedMap} whose comparator is not consistent
* with {@code equals}.
*
* <p>The {@code standard} methods and the collection views they return are not
* guaranteed to be thread-safe, even when all of the methods that they depend
* on are thread-safe.
*
* @author Kevin Bourrillion
* @author Jared Levy
* @author Louis Wasserman
* @since 2.0
*/
@GwtCompatible
public abstract class ForwardingMap<K, V> extends ForwardingObject implements Map {
// TODO(lowasser): identify places where thread safety is actually lost
/** Constructor for use by subclasses. */
protected ForwardingMap() {}
@Override
protected abstract Map<K, V> delegate();
@Override
public int size() {
return delegate().size();
}
@Override
public boolean isEmpty() {
return delegate().isEmpty();
}
@CanIgnoreReturnValue
@Override
public V remove(Object object) {
return delegate().remove(object);
}
@Override
public void clear() {
delegate().clear();
}
@Override
public boolean containsKey(@Nullable Object key) {
return delegate().containsKey(key);
}
@Override
public boolean containsValue(@Nullable Object value) {
return delegate().containsValue(value);
}
@Override
public V get(@Nullable Object key) {
return delegate().get(key);
}
@CanIgnoreReturnValue
@Override
public V put(K key, V value) {
return delegate().put(key, value);
}
@Override
public void putAll(Map<? extends K, ? extends V> map) {
delegate().putAll(map);
}
@Override
public Set<K> keySet() {
return delegate().keySet();
}
@Override
public Collection<V> values() {
return delegate().values();
}
@Override
public Set<Entry entrySet() {
return delegate().entrySet();
}
@Override
public boolean equals(@Nullable Object object) {
return object == this || delegate().equals(object);
}
@Override
public int hashCode() {
return delegate().hashCode();
}
/**
* A sensible definition of {@link #putAll(Map)} in terms of {@link
* #put(Object, Object)}. If you override {@link #put(Object, Object)}, you
* may wish to override {@link #putAll(Map)} to forward to this
* implementation.
*
* @since 7.0
*/
protected void standardPutAll(Map<? extends K, ? extends V> map) {
Maps.putAllImpl(this, map);
}
/**
* A sensible, albeit inefficient, definition of {@link #remove} in terms of
* the {@code iterator} method of {@link #entrySet}. If you override {@link
* #entrySet}, you may wish to override {@link #remove} to forward to this
* implementation.
*
* <p>Alternately, you may wish to override {@link #remove} with {@code
* keySet().remove}, assuming that approach would not lead to an infinite
* loop.
*
* @since 7.0
*/
@Beta
protected V standardRemove(@Nullable Object key) {
Iterator<Entry entryIterator = entrySet().iterator();
while (entryIterator.hasNext()) {
Entry<K, V> entry = entryIterator.next();
if (Objects.equal(entry.getKey(), key)) {
V value = entry.getValue();
entryIterator.remove();
return value;
}
}
return null;
}
/**
* A sensible definition of {@link #clear} in terms of the {@code iterator}
* method of {@link #entrySet}. In many cases, you may wish to override
* {@link #clear} to forward to this implementation.
*
* @since 7.0
*/
protected void standardClear() {
Iterators.clear(entrySet().iterator());
}
/**
* A sensible implementation of {@link Map#keySet} in terms of the following
* methods: {@link ForwardingMap#clear}, {@link ForwardingMap#containsKey},
* {@link ForwardingMap#isEmpty}, {@link ForwardingMap#remove}, {@link
* ForwardingMap#size}, and the {@link Set#iterator} method of {@link
* ForwardingMap#entrySet}. In many cases, you may wish to override {@link
* ForwardingMap#keySet} to forward to this implementation or a subclass
* thereof.
*
* @since 10.0
*/
@Beta
protected class StandardKeySet extends Maps.KeySet<K, V> {
/** Constructor for use by subclasses. */
public StandardKeySet() {
super(ForwardingMap.this);
}
}
/**
* A sensible, albeit inefficient, definition of {@link #containsKey} in terms
* of the {@code iterator} method of {@link #entrySet}. If you override {@link
* #entrySet}, you may wish to override {@link #containsKey} to forward to
* this implementation.
*
* @since 7.0
*/
@Beta
protected boolean standardContainsKey(@Nullable Object key) {
return Maps.containsKeyImpl(this, key);
}
/**
* A sensible implementation of {@link Map#values} in terms of the following
* methods: {@link ForwardingMap#clear}, {@link ForwardingMap#containsValue},
* {@link ForwardingMap#isEmpty}, {@link ForwardingMap#size}, and the {@link
* Set#iterator} method of {@link ForwardingMap#entrySet}. In many cases, you
* may wish to override {@link ForwardingMap#values} to forward to this
* implementation or a subclass thereof.
*
* @since 10.0
*/
@Beta
protected class StandardValues extends Maps.Values<K, V> {
/** Constructor for use by subclasses. */
public StandardValues() {
super(ForwardingMap.this);
}
}
/**
* A sensible definition of {@link #containsValue} in terms of the {@code
* iterator} method of {@link #entrySet}. If you override {@link #entrySet},
* you may wish to override {@link #containsValue} to forward to this
* implementation.
*
* @since 7.0
*/
protected boolean standardContainsValue(@Nullable Object value) {
return Maps.containsValueImpl(this, value);
}
/**
* A sensible implementation of {@link Map#entrySet} in terms of the following
* methods: {@link ForwardingMap#clear}, {@link ForwardingMap#containsKey},
* {@link ForwardingMap#get}, {@link ForwardingMap#isEmpty}, {@link
* ForwardingMap#remove}, and {@link ForwardingMap#size}. In many cases, you
* may wish to override {@link #entrySet} to forward to this implementation
* or a subclass thereof.
*
* @since 10.0
*/
@Beta
protected abstract class StandardEntrySet extends Maps.EntrySet<K, V> {
/** Constructor for use by subclasses. */
public StandardEntrySet() {}
@Override
Map<K, V> map() {
return ForwardingMap.this;
}
}
/**
* A sensible definition of {@link #isEmpty} in terms of the {@code iterator}
* method of {@link #entrySet}. If you override {@link #entrySet}, you may
* wish to override {@link #isEmpty} to forward to this implementation.
*
* @since 7.0
*/
protected boolean standardIsEmpty() {
return !entrySet().iterator().hasNext();
}
/**
* A sensible definition of {@link #equals} in terms of the {@code equals}
* method of {@link #entrySet}. If you override {@link #entrySet}, you may
* wish to override {@link #equals} to forward to this implementation.
*
* @since 7.0
*/
protected boolean standardEquals(@Nullable Object object) {
return Maps.equalsImpl(this, object);
}
/**
* A sensible definition of {@link #hashCode} in terms of the {@code iterator}
* method of {@link #entrySet}. If you override {@link #entrySet}, you may
* wish to override {@link #hashCode} to forward to this implementation.
*
* @since 7.0
*/
protected int standardHashCode() {
return Sets.hashCodeImpl(entrySet());
}
/**
* A sensible definition of {@link #toString} in terms of the {@code iterator}
* method of {@link #entrySet}. If you override {@link #entrySet}, you may
* wish to override {@link #toString} to forward to this implementation.
*
* @since 7.0
*/
protected String standardToString() {
return Maps.toStringImpl(this);
}
}
